sorry, but i have a second question: The new prime number is M32582657, isnt it? and it has 9,808,358 digits.
the number I'm testing is M30223751,
my number is smaller then the new prime and so my number couldn't have more then 10.000.000 digits?
Correct. In fact you can calculate number of digits by the formula:
# of digits = ceil(n * log(2) / log(10))

In your case, this will be 30223751 * log(2) / log(10) = 9,098,256 digits.
